推荐 10 个不错的网络监视工具,值得珍藏

推荐 10 个不错的网络监视工具,值得珍藏

0基础学习华为网络交换机划分VLAN

有几个网络监视工具可以用于差别的操作系统。在这篇文章中,我们将讨论从 linux 终端中运行的 10 个网络监视工具。

它对不使用 GUI 而希望通过 SSH 来保持对网络治理的用户来说是异常理想的。

1、iftop

推荐 10 个不错的网络监视工具,值得珍藏

 

iftop network monitoring tool

Linux 用户通常都熟悉 top —— 这是一个系统监视工具,它允许我们知道在我们的系统中实时运行的历程,并可以很容易地治理它们。

iftop 与 top 应用程序类似,但它是专门监视网络的,通过它可以知道更多的关于网络的详细情形和使用网络的所有历程。

2、vnstat

推荐 10 个不错的网络监视工具,值得珍藏

 

vnstat network monitoring tool

vnstat 是一个缺省包含在大多数 Linux 发行版中的网络监视工具。它允许我们对一个用户选择的时间周期内发送和吸收的流量举行实时控制。

3、IPTraf

 

推荐 10 个不错的网络监视工具,值得珍藏

 

iptraf monitoring tool for linux

IPTraf 是一个基于控制台的 Linux 实时网络监视程序。它会网络经由这个网络的林林总总的信息作为一个 IP 流量监视器,包罗 TCP 标志信息、ICMP 详细情形、TCP / UDP 流量故障、TCP 毗邻包和字节计数。它也网络接口上所有的 TCP、UDP、…… IP 协媾和非 IP 协议 ICMP 的校验和错误、接口流动等等的详细情形。

4、Monitorix – 系统和网络监视

推荐 10 个不错的网络监视工具,值得珍藏

 

monitorix system monitoring tool for linux

Monitorix 是一个轻量级的免费应用程序,它设计用于去监视尽可能多的 Linux / Unix 服务器的系统和网络资源。

它内里添加了一个 HTTP web 服务器,可以定期去网络系统和网络信息,而且在一个图表中显示它们。它跟踪平均系统负载、内存分配、磁盘康健状态、系统服务、网络端口、邮件统计信息(Sendmail、Postfix、Dovecot 等等)、MySQL 统计信息以及其它的更多内容。它设计用于去治理系统的整体性能,以及辅助检测故障、瓶颈、异常流动等等。

5、dstat

推荐 10 个不错的网络监视工具,值得珍藏

 

dstat network monitoring tool

这个监视器相比前面的几个知名度低一些,然则,在一些发行版中已经缺省包含了。

6、bwm-ng

 

移动解析新思路:HttpDNS解决方案

推荐 10 个不错的网络监视工具,值得珍藏

 

bwm-ng monitoring tool

这是最简化的工具之一。它允许你去从毗邻中交互式取得数据,而且,为了便于其它装备使用,在取得数据的同时,能以某些花样导出它们。

7、ibmonitor

推荐 10 个不错的网络监视工具,值得珍藏

 

ibmonitor tool for linux

与上面的类似,它显示毗邻接口上过滤后的网络流量,而且,明确地将吸收流量和发送流量区离开。

8、Htop – Linux 历程跟踪

 

推荐 10 个不错的网络监视工具,值得珍藏

 

htop linux processes monitoring tool

Htop 是一个更先进的、交互式的、实时的 Linux 历程跟踪工具。它类似于 Linux 的 top 下令,然则有一些更高级的特征,好比,一个更易于使用的历程治理界面、快捷键、水平和垂直的历程视图等更多特征。

Htop 是一个第三方工具,它不包含在 Linux 系统中,你必须使用 YUM 或者 APT-GET 或者其它的包治理工具去安装它。

9、arpwatch – 以太网流动监视器

推荐 10 个不错的网络监视工具,值得珍藏

 

arpwatch ethernet monitoring tool

arpwatch 是一个设计用于在 Linux 网络中去治理以太网通讯的地址剖析程序。它连续监视以太网通讯并纪录一个网络中的 IP 地址和 mac 地址的转变,该转变同时也会纪录一个时间戳。

它也有一个功效是当一对 IP 和 MAC 地址被添加或者发生转变时,发送一封邮件给系统治理员。在一个网络中发生 ARP 攻击时,这个功效异常有用。

10、Wireshark – 网络监视工具

推荐 10 个不错的网络监视工具,值得珍藏

 

wireshark network monitoring tool

Wireshark 是一个自由的应用程序,它允许你去捕捉和查看前往你的系统和从你的系统中返回的信息,它可以去深入到数据包中并查看每个包的内容 —— 以划分知足你的差别需求。它一样平常用于去研究协议问题和去创建和测试程序的稀奇情形。这个开源分析器是一个被公认的分析器商业尺度,它的盛行要归功于其久负盛名。

最初它被叫做 Ethereal,Wireshark 有轻量化的、易于明白的界面,它能分类显示来自差别的真实系统上的协议信息。

结论

在这篇文章中,我们看了几个开源的网络监视工具。虽然我们从这些工具中挑选出来的认为是“最佳的”,并不意味着它们都是最适合你的需要的。

例如,现在有许多的开源监视工具,好比,OpenNMS、Cacti、和 Zennos,而且,你需要去从你的个体情形思量它们的每个工具的优势。

另外,另有差别的、更适合你的需要的不开源的工具。

你知道的或者使用的在 Linux 终端中的更多网络监视工具另有哪些?若是对你有辅助,可以分享给更多的人,让人人都能受用!

核心交换机中链路聚合、冗余、堆叠、热备份技术介绍

分享到 :
相关推荐

发表评论

登录... 后才能评论